  3. The most recent country to earn UN recognition is South Sudan, gaining its independence in 2011 following a brutal, decades-long civil war with Sudan. Following closely behind is Montenegro, which split from its State Union with Serbia to establish its sovereignty in 2006.

  6. Nov 2, 2022 · 1. South Sudan - July 2011. Aerial of Juba, the capital of South Sudan, with the River Nile on the right. Formally referred to as the Republic of South Sudan, this landlocked East-Central African nation gained independence from the Republic of the Sudan on July 9, 2011, after several years of conflict between the two countries.
